For Pesach: Baby Lamb Chops with Wine Vinaigrette


lServes 6

15 baby lamb chops

2 cups red wine

1 tablespoon honey

1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il

1 tablespoon chopped fresh rosemary leaves

1 teaspoon kosher salt , plus more for seasoning

1 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per, plus more for seasoning

Place a grill pan over medium-high heat or preheat a gas or charcoal grill. Season the lamb with salt and pepper. Grill until caramel-colored grill marks appear, and an instant-read meat thermometer registers 125 degrees F. for medium-rare, about 5 to 7 minutes per side, depending on thickness.
Meanwhile, place the wine in a medium saucepan over medium-high heat. Boil gently until reduced to 1 cup, about 15 minutes. Turn off the heat. Whisk in the honey until dissolved. Add the extra-virgin olive oil, rosemary, salt, and pepper. Whisk to combine. This can be made up to 3 days in advance and should be made at least one day in advance so that the flavors really blend well together.
Serve the lamb chops on a platter with a serving bowl of the wine vinaigrette alongside for drizzling over the meat. This should be served at room temperature which makes it great for Shabbos or Yom Tov day.
